Trip Type: Business Review 1 of 12Fantastic Hotel. Looks New!
This hotel is by far the nicest (even over the Hilton) in FtLauderdale. Continental breakfast was included! Entire staff is excellent. The hotel looks new . . very Soho. Only downside is no ice in the full size refrigerator in the room . . and no ice machine that I could find. Also - they dont use fitted sheets on the bed, so the sheet wouldn't stay in place.

Trip Type: Business Review 3 of 12Great Rate---Great Place
I am seasoned traveler and I will say that the rooms at the Il Lugano were fantastic. 3 times larger than a standard hotel room. I was in town for an entire week on business and it made the time away from home easier. Great beds, beautiful view over the intercoastal. Great patio too, plenty of room to dry my dive gear. The mandatory valet parking was a little cheesy, i use it but I think it should be an option anywhere you stay. I will definately stay here again.

Trip Type: Business Review 8 of 12Nice Hotel But Parking fees $25.00 per night
Very nice new hotel, Service was excellent, greeted in professional mannor. Beds were very comfortable. Great location. Parking is valet only and is $25.00/night. I decided to park at a meter in front of the hotel which is only monitored from 8am to 6pm. I was on the beach and cruzing fort lauderdale all day anyway so I just parked at the meter. But had to be there to feed the meter by 8am.

Trip Type: Business Review 10 of 12This hotel is AWESOME!!!!
The hotel is very close to the beach, close to a few bars, restaurants, & shopping. My hotel room had a washer & dryer, full-sized refrigerator, two flat screen TVs with DirectTV and a dishwasher. They have their own private boat to rent, private pool & jacuzzi & a little man-made beach on their property. They have a brand new gym & soon they'll have a restaurant. Each room has a full-sized balcony. And they offer free shuttle service in a 3-5 mile radius of the hotel via new Cadillac Escalades. I loved this hotel!!!!!
